- Special
education is a system
-
of services and supports designed for
children with disabilities. All children however, have learning
differences and a variety of needs. Our success as educators must be
measured against the achievement of all children entrusted to our care.
Each school within the Cleveland Municipal School District has the
responsibility for educating all children, preparing all children for a
place in their community. Research confirms that the most effective
schools are those that design a system of integrated service delivery
that provides targeted interventions, opportunity for enrichment, and
positive behavioral supports for both general and special populations.
Through teamwork, collaborative problem-solving, a focus on student
learning, and a belief that all children have a right to quality
education, we will ensure educational opportunity for all; we will
recognize and protect the dignity and worth of all children in our
school communities.
We will ensure
that no child is left behind.
